We are seeking a skilled commercial electrician to play a crucial role in the installation, maintenance and repair of solar photovoltaic (PV) systems. You will have a strong background in commercial and utilities electrical work, a passion for renewable energy and a commitment to safety.
RenEnergy are at the forefront of the renewable energy revolution. As a dynamic rapidly growing innovator we envision a world powered by clean energy and work tirelessly to turn that vision into reality. As we continue to grow and expand our operations, we are seeking an experienced Electrician to join our installations team.
Key responsibilities include:
- Install solar PV systems, including panels, inverters and battery storage units in line with technical design specifications and according to industry standards and regulations.
- Ensure all installations comply with UK electrical standard, IET wiring regulations and H&S standards.
- Maintain up to date knowledge on industry technologies and legislation.
- Continuous monitoring to maintain excellent levels of H&S on site.
- Communicate effectively with clients regarding project timelines, system performance and maintenance needs.
- Provide technical support and guidance to clients, ensuring a positive customer experience.
- Prepare and maintain detailed reports and documentation for installations, maintenance and repairs including compliance checks.
- Assist with the completion of necessary paperwork for permits and grid connection applications.
About you:
We are looking for the following skills, knowledge and experience:
- NVQ Level 3 in Electrical Installation.
- 17th/18th Edition IET Wiring Regulations Certificate.
- Experience in Solar PV installation desirable.
- Strong understanding of commercial and utilities electrical systems and safety protocols.
- Excellent troubleshooting and problem solving abilities.
- Ability to work independently or as part of a team.
- Excellent organisational and communication skills are essential.
- Physical fitness and ability to work at heights.
- Must have a full, clean UK Drivers Licence.
- Must have a ECS Gold Card.
